WebJun 3, 1992 · Born May 26, 1908 Died June 03, 1992 Biography Read More Portly English character actor who first gained acclaim on the London stage for his title role in "Oscar Wilde." Morley successfully reprised the part on Broadway in 1938, leading to an invitation to Hollywood and an Oscar-nominated film debut as Louis XVI in "Marie Antoinette" (1938). WebRobert Morley, (born May 26, 1908, Semley, Wiltshire, Eng.—died June 3, 1992, Reading, Berkshire), prolific English actor, director, and playwright whose forte was comedy and comedy-drama. Morley was a graduate of the Royal Academy of Dramatic Art, London, … WebJun 3, 1992 · Actor. Born in Semley, England, he was noted for his supporting roles, usually cast as a pompous English gentleman. In 1929, he began his career on London's West End stage and made his Broadway debut in 1938. That same year, he was cast in the role of …
